New Jersey Devils forward Timo Meier underwent arthroscopic surgery on his shoulder Tuesday.
Meier, 27, is predicted to make a full restoration from the elective process in time for coaching camp.
He registered 52 factors (28 objectives, 24 assists) in 69 video games in his first full season with the Devils in 2023-24.
New Jersey acquired Meier from the San Jose Sharks in a multiplayer deal on Feb. 26, 2023.
Drafted ninth total by San Jose in 2015, Meier has 382 factors (191 objectives, 191 assists) in 541 profession video games.
